Purple Heart Hunt

This story follows Emily, a young girl on a quest to find her grandfather’s missing Purple Heart medal, a cherished symbol of his bravery during World War II. The medal had been lost for years, and Emily knew finding it would bring great joy to her grandfather. She searches through old boxes in the attic, discovering letters, photographs, and mementos along the way. Finally, Emily uncovers the medal and plans to surprise her grandfather with it, knowing how much it would mean to him.

This passage enhances critical thinking and problem-solving skills as students follow Emily’s methodical search for the medal. It introduces historical vocabulary, like “Purple Heart” and “World War II,” expanding historical knowledge and vocabulary. The emotional aspect of the story helps students connect with the narrative, fostering empathy and comprehension. Additionally, students can analyze how descriptive language and story pacing are used to build suspense and emotion.
